This 43B Advanced Flying School graduation book was owned by my father, Lt. Col. John M. Carah. After graduation in February, 1943, he as assigned as a pilot to the 381st Bomb Group. He was shot down over France on 4 Jul 1943 and evaded to Switzerland where he became a member of the Military Attache's staff. He left Switzerland and returned to the U.S. after crossing occupied France and reaching Barcelona, Spain in February, 1944. After his return to the U.S., he became a pilot for the ATC Ferry Service and later made the U.S. Air Force his career. He retired in 1966.
